The widespread flooding led to evacuations in New Zealand’s biggest city, closing the airport and forcing the cancellation of an Elton John concert.
A state of emergency was declared in New Zealand’s biggest city Auckland on Friday as torrential rains caused widespread flooding and evacuations, closing the city’s airports and forcing organisers to cancel a scheduled concert by Elton John.
The agency advised residents in flood-prone areas to prepare to evacuate and opened an evacuation centre in West Auckland. Major roads were also blocked by the floods, causing long traffic queues on highways. Police said they were working with Fire and Emergency New Zealand to respond to calls and asked people to stay off the roads if possible.One TV
